-              The Transportation Construction Apprenticeship Readiness Training program (TCART) is a crucial initiative sponsored by Senator Lightford through IDOT that creates transportation job opportunities for otherwise untrained job seekers. The Senator is pictured here with Austin People Action Center (APAC) Executive Director Cynthia Williams and some apprentices in the program as they advocate for funds at the Capitol after the governor's budget address.

-              Last summer, Senator Lightford carried legislation through the Senate that changed the name of the portion of Cicero Avenue that runs through Senate District 4 to Mandela Avenue. She is pictured here with Representative LaShawn K. Ford (who sponsored the legislation in the House) and others to commemorate and celebrate the man whose name now graces this stretch of road.
